@article{Adhikari_Shrestha_Gautam_Pokharel_2021, title={Transmission Dynamics of COVID-19 in Nepal}, volume={13}, url={https://nepjol.info/index.php/hssj/article/view/44560}, DOI={10.3126/hssj.v13i1.44560}, abstractNote={<p>In this paper, we use the basic SEIR model to study the transmission dynamics of COVID-19 in Nepal. Fitting the model with the data of Nepal, we estimated 26% of Seroprevalence from 13 March, 2021 and the level of control strategies to reduce COVID-19 cases in Nepal. The value of β is approximated 0.0536 for the study period. Reduction of β by 25%, 50%, 75%, reduces reported cumulative cases by the end of 13th March, 2021 by 34.5%, 55.6% and 68.7% respectively.</p>}, number={1}, journal={Humanities and Social Sciences Journal}, author={Adhikari, Khagendra and Shrestha, Dhan Bahadur and Gautam, Ramesh and Pokharel, Anjana}, year={2021}, month={Aug.}, pages={155–169} }
